We start the new year with a massive drone release, featuring more then 13 hours of bass dronescapes.
But let´s start from the beginning. RSN is the current Moniker of Thomas Rosen (Ninemiles, [ B O L T ]), with a focus on minimal dronescapes created on bass. He already released a couple of records including some collaborations (for example with N) and now it´s time for us to present his massive opus “cutouts #1”.
“cutouts #1” features 14 tracks. It starts with a live recording, which marks the beginning of 12 following loop tracks, which end up in another live track. We know that 13 hours of drone music sound very heavy, but it is worth it to listen to those hour long loops, framed by two excellent live sessions.
The album got mastered by Oliver Barrett (Petrels), who pointed out the massive drones, so you have a warm and raw feeling while listening.
RSN about the album
“cutouts #1” is the documentation of the installation “flowing & absorbing cutouts”, which combines abstract photographs with looped sounds. The installation began with a live concert that transitioned into three constantly shifting loops. Two weeks later, the installation ended with a final concert, which developed out of the still running loops. “cutouts #1” therefore consists of 14 tracks, with each track representing one day of the installation’s duration. The music is based on the photographs in the series. It is flowing and light, has foggy structures and enables an endless deep immersion. Everything seems to be in a bubble, floating through an intangible space – a long journey, a gentle feeling.
